πŸ“š Introduction: The Interconnectedness of Life

Ecosystems are complex networks of living organisms (plants, animals, and microbes) interacting with their non-living environment (air, water, soil, and sunlight). Healthy ecosystems provide essential services to humans, including the purification of air and water. When these ecosystems are damaged or degraded, our access to these vital resources is compromised.

πŸ“œ Historical Context: Recognizing Ecosystem Services

The understanding of ecosystem services is relatively recent, gaining prominence in the late 20th century. Early ecological studies focused on the intrinsic value of nature. However, as human impact on the environment increased, scientists and policymakers began to recognize the economic and social importance of ecosystem services. Landmark reports like the Millennium Ecosystem Assessment (2005) highlighted the crucial role of ecosystems in human well-being.

🌱 Key Principles: How Ecosystems Provide Clean Air and Water

  • 🌳 Air Purification by Plants: Plants absorb carbon dioxide ($CO_2$) during photosynthesis and release oxygen ($O_2$), a process vital for human respiration. They also filter out pollutants from the air. The equation representing photosynthesis is: $6CO_2 + 6H_2O + Sunlight \rightarrow C_6H_{12}O_6 + 6O_2$.
  • πŸ’§ Water Filtration by Wetlands: Wetlands, such as marshes and swamps, act as natural filters, removing sediments, nutrients, and pollutants from water. Plants and microbes in wetlands absorb excess nutrients like nitrogen and phosphorus, preventing them from entering waterways.
  • 🌍 Soil Health and Water Quality: Healthy soil, rich in organic matter, improves water infiltration and reduces runoff. This minimizes soil erosion and prevents pollutants from entering rivers and lakes. Soil microorganisms also break down pollutants, further purifying water.
  • 🌧️ Forests and Watershed Protection: Forests play a crucial role in regulating water cycles. Their canopies intercept rainfall, reducing the impact on the ground and preventing erosion. Forest roots bind the soil together, further stabilizing slopes and preventing landslides. They act as natural reservoirs, slowly releasing water into streams and rivers, ensuring a steady supply of clean water.
  • 🦠 Microbial Decomposition: Microorganisms, like bacteria and fungi, break down organic matter and pollutants in both soil and water. This process, known as decomposition, is essential for nutrient cycling and the removal of contaminants.
  • 🌊 Riparian Buffers: Riparian buffers are vegetated areas along the banks of rivers and streams. They act as filters, trapping sediment and pollutants before they enter the water. They also provide shade, which helps to regulate water temperature and support aquatic life.
  • 🧽 Oyster Reefs: Oyster reefs filter large volumes of water. As oysters feed, they remove algae, sediment, and pollutants, improving water clarity and quality. A single oyster can filter up to 50 gallons of water per day!

🏞️ Real-world Examples: Case Studies in Ecosystem Restoration

  • πŸ“ The Chesapeake Bay Program: This program focuses on restoring the Chesapeake Bay ecosystem by reducing pollution from agriculture, urban runoff, and sewage treatment plants. Efforts include planting trees, restoring wetlands, and implementing best management practices on farms.
  • 🏞️ The Everglades Restoration Project: This ambitious project aims to restore the natural flow of water through the Everglades ecosystem in Florida. By removing canals and levees, the project seeks to rehydrate wetlands, improve water quality, and support the region's biodiversity.
  • 🌳 Reforestation Efforts in the Amazon: Deforestation in the Amazon rainforest has significant impacts on regional and global climate, as well as water cycles. Reforestation projects aim to restore degraded forests, improve water quality, and sequester carbon dioxide from the atmosphere.

πŸ“ Conclusion: Protecting Ecosystems for a Sustainable Future

Healthy ecosystems are essential for providing clean air and water, vital resources for human health and well-being. Protecting and restoring ecosystems requires a multifaceted approach, including reducing pollution, conserving natural resources, and promoting sustainable land management practices. By recognizing the value of ecosystem services and investing in their protection, we can ensure a sustainable future for ourselves and future generations.
